The Regal Princess was delayed from departing Galveston due to an oil spill at the Texas port that occurred Oct. 28.
A portion of the Galveston Ship Channel was closed after the spill, according to the U.S. Coast Guard.
The ship had been scheduled to depart the port on Oct. 29 but couldn't due to the partial channel closure and because its hull needed to be cleaned of oil, said a Princess spokesperson. The ship's departure was rescheduled for Oct. 30.
The spill's source is secured and the cause is under investigation, the Coast Guard said.
The Carnival Breeze was scheduled to arrive to Galveston on Oct. 30 and docked at Terminal 10 instead of the originally scheduled Terminal 28.
